Photo by Will MatuskaUnsheltered homelessness down, according to July snapshotFewer people may be experiencing unsheltered homelessness in Boulder, according to the city’s latest point-in-time count released this month. “Over the last two years, we have seen a reduction in the number of individuals who are unsheltered and living outside,” said Kurt Firnhaber, director of Housing and Human Services, in a press release.
